County Ground, Taunton

The County Solid ground is a cricket solid ground in Taunton, Somerset. It is the property of Somerset County Cricket Club, who have played there because 1882. The solid ground, which is found in between Abbey Bridge Highway and St. James Road in Taunton has an ability in extra of 6,500. The solid ground was created as element of a sports center by Taunton Athletic Club in 1881, as well as became the home of the in the past nomadic Somerset County Cricket Club very soon after. After renting out the solid ground for ten years, the club acquired the ground in 1896, under the guidance of club clerk Holly Murray-Anderdon. The solid ground ends are End to the north as well as the Old Pavilion End to the south.

Somerset played their 1st match of first-rate cricket on the solid ground over 8-- 10 August 1882, defeating Hampshire County Cricket Club by five wickets. Later in the same month, the travelling Australia national cricket group played a match from Somerset, coming to be the initial global side to bet at the ground. The 1st intercontinental cricket to be used the solid ground was during the 1983 Cricket Globe Cup, for a group-stage match between England as well as Sri Lanka. The ground additionally hosted two group-stage matches during the 1999 Cricket World Mug. Since 1997, females's worldwide cricket has actually been wagered at the ground, and in 2006 it became the house of the England girls's cricket crew.

The pitch at the County Solid ground is surrounded by a number of stands and also structures. The associates' areas, located at End of the solid ground is composed of the Colin Atkinson Structure, the Sir Ian Botham Stand and the Marcus Trescothick stand.
